Utilizing technology effectively in schools plays a crucial role in elevating educational quality and efficiency. The integration of technology into various aspects of the educational environment supports enhanced learning experiences for students and promotes better teaching practices. For instance, interactive tools like smartboards and educational software can enrich the classroom experience, enabling more engaging and personalized learning opportunities.

Furthermore, technology can streamline administrative processes, such as grading, attendance tracking, and communication between staff and parents, which contributes to overall efficiency. By integrating technology in these ways, schools can create an environment that not only fosters better academic outcomes but also prepares students for a technology-driven world.
